Ghost Installation: A Comprehensive Guide

Ghost installation, a term commonly experienced in the realms of computing and system provisioning, describes the process of releasing a pre-configured disk image to computers or servers. This method enhances the installation process, making it particularly valuable for companies wanting to set up numerous systems efficiently. This short article looks into the concept of ghost installation, its applications, advantages, and a comprehensive summary of the procedure involved.

What is Ghost Installation?

Ghost installation is mostly related to disk imaging innovation. A disk image is a total copy of the contents of a storage device, consisting of the os, applications, configurations, and files. Key Technologies

Ghost installation frequently leverages advanced imaging software. Noteworthy choices consist of:

  • Norton Ghost: One of the original disk imaging tools that promoted the term "ghosting" in the 1990s.
  • Clonezilla: An open-source software option known for its versatility and cost-effectiveness.
  • Microsoft Deployment Toolkit (MDT): An extensive tool that enables automated Windows installations using disk images.
  • Acronis Snap Deploy: A paid solution that uses robust imaging abilities and advanced management features.

Table 1: Comparison of Ghost Installation Software

Software applicationCostPlatforms SupportedRelieve of UseKey Features
Norton GhostPaidWindowsModerateFull disk backups, incremental cloning
ClonezillaFreeWindows, LinuxModerateDisk imaging, cloning, repair
Microsoft Deployment ToolkitFreeWindowsEasyAutomated installations, job sequencing
Acronis Snap DeployPaidWindows, LinuxEasyMulticast release, central management

Benefits of Ghost Installation

Ghost installations offer numerous advantages, especially for IT departments handling various devices. Some benefits consist of:

  1. Time Efficiency: Manual installations can be time-consuming. Ghost installation permits the quick deployment of the exact same setup throughout several systems.
  2. Consistency: Ensures that all devices have an uniform setup, which lowers compatibility concerns and streamlines assistance.
  3. Cost-Effectiveness: By reducing the time invested in installations, organizations can decrease labor costs.
  4. Disaster Recovery: Having a dependable disk image helps with quicker healing from system failures, enabling fast repair of service.
  5. Scalability: Ghost installation processes can be quickly scaled up or down depending on the requirements of the organization, making it adaptable to various environments.

The Ghost Installation Process

Carrying out a ghost installation needs mindful preparation and execution. Below is a general overview of the actions included in this process:

Step 1: Create a Master Image

  • Set up one system with the desired os, applications, security settings, and configurations.
  • Use disk imaging software application to catch the configuration, creating a master image.

Action 2: Prepare Target Machines

  • Make sure that all target makers fulfill the prerequisites set in the master system.
  • Make required hardware modifications, if any, to accommodate the installation.

Action 3: Deploy the Image

  • Boot target machines utilizing a network boot (PXE) or a bootable USB/CD containing the imaging software.
  • Select the master image to be deployed and start the installation procedure.

Step 4: Post-Installation

  • As soon as installed, perform necessary checks to ensure that the system operates as expected.
  • Apply last-minute configurations or updates.
  • Guarantee that all systems are safely configured and linked to the network.

Step 5: Regular Updates

  • Keep the master image upgraded with the most recent software spots, configurations, and applications.
  • Regularly review and revitalize the master image to guarantee security and efficiency.

Regularly Asked Questions (FAQs)

What is the difference between cloning and ghost installation?

Cloning generally refers to developing a specific, one-time copy of a disk, while ghost installation includes releasing a pre-configured image over several makers for mass implementations.

Can ghost installations be performed across different hardware?

Yes, but hardware compatibility can posture obstacles. It is necessary to check driver support and hardware compatibility for the target devices before releasing the master image.

Is it possible to revert modifications made after a ghost installation?

Yes, if the initial master image is preserved, it can be redeployed to revert any unintended modifications or configurations.

How typically should the master image be updated?

Regular updates are advised, preferably each time considerable software application updates or changes take place. As a general guideline, preserving a fresh image with the current security updates is advisable.
